Output ec28f3d67581faca1d5e2b7ab052f724571fbfbafa900b0a692223e28f8adbd7:8

value
40900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69a21e6b6884aec783155ce3c5f284faed6139f7 OP_EQUAL
address
3BKZ5u87UvqaQZqSLYxqU6X41DoYZLyzCQ
transaction
ec28f3d67581faca1d5e2b7ab052f724571fbfbafa900b0a692223e28f8adbd7
spent
true